Internal Memo — Currency Hedging Call

Branch managers,

Quick heads-up: treasury has decided to hedge 70% of our crown-denominated receivables for the next four quarters. The crown has been jumpy since the Aldermere elections, and we'd rather lock in predictable margins than gamble on a rebound. Practically, this means your pricing sheets for export accounts stay stable through year-end — no mid-quarter surprises. Costs of the hedge come off the central line, not branch P&Ls. The thinking behind this connects to a bigger move, noted below.

confidential, kagep-kahof: Druokax Systems plans to lower the Ulaath list price by 53 percent in March.

**Action item (INC-catalog-stale):** During the Lanterow catalog incident, invalidation messages were dropped when the fanout queue saturated, so shoppers saw withdrawn listings for several hours. We will move invalidation to a versioned-key scheme with short hard TTLs as a backstop, so a missed message can never extend exposure beyond one TTL window. Security should review because stale entries briefly served delisted restricted items. The proposed TTL and queue bounds are captured below for review.

tuning constants:
QUOTAS = {
    "druwyn": 5,
    "holix": 5,
    "zorath": 5,
    "holwyn": 10,
}

## Authentication

Heads up: the nightly reindex job (`reindex_nightly.py`) talks to the Lanternfish search cluster, and that cluster won't accept anonymous writes anymore — we locked it down last sprint. The job now authenticates as the `reindex-runner` service identity against Corvid Gateway, and the token is injected via the `LF_INDEX_TOKEN` env var in the scheduler config. Nothing clever going on, just a bearer header on every batch request. For review purposes, the staging credential currently in use is listed below.

service key, kadug-kadup: kto15_rN23XLAYImmZgrJ

## Calendar sync conflict (Plannerly ↔ Duskwell)

When a customer reports duplicate or vanishing events, first confirm whether both the Plannerly client and the Duskwell connector claim ownership of the same event series. Conflicts typically appear after a timezone change or a recurring-event edit made on both sides within the sync window. Do not delete events manually — this worsens the divergence. Capture the sync log excerpt, then follow the resolution procedure documented on the internal page below.

runbook for badug-kadup: https://confluence.zemvarlabs.internal/projects/browse/display/projects/bd1b